A preliminary plat automatically expires and is void if the applicant fails to file for approval of the final plat within:

A. Seven years of the effective date of preliminary plat approval if preliminary plat approval is on or before December 31, 2014; or

B. Five years of the effective date of preliminary plat approval if preliminary plat approval is on or after January 1, 2015; or

C. Ten years of the effective date of preliminary plat approval if the project is not subject to requirements adopted under Chapter 90.58 RCW and the date of preliminary plat approval is on or before December 31, 2007.

Provided, that, if the plat is a phased development and the applicant has received an extension for the preliminary plat pursuant to LUC 20.45A.150, these time limitations may be increased by the length of the approved extension. (Ord. 6197, 11-17-14, § 33; Ord. 4972, 3-3-97, § 28; Ord. 4816, 11-27-95, § 126; Ord. 3937, 7-18-88)
